买专利卖专利找龙图腾,真高效! 查专利查商标用IPTOP,全免费!专利年费监控用IP管家,真方便!
申请/专利权人:健康云(上海)数字科技有限公司
摘要:本发明涉及一种基于国密算法实现的个人隐私数据保存方法,采用了SM3、SM3、AES组合多级加密,并将用户登录密码做为密钥之一,参与到数据加密中,保证不同用户uKey有所不同。本发明设计了一种支持脱机运行的隐私数据保存方案,利用对称加密和非对称加密中的多种加密方式进行组合多级加密,密文密钥本地化存储,本发明不依赖网络通过口令生成uKey,提高了保密效果,并降低了窃取或泄露可能性。本发明用于隐私程度要求比较高的信息存储,减少数据遗忘、窃取或泄露事件的发生,满足使用者需求,提高了敏感数据保存的安全性。本发明的应用范围包括但不限于:网站类账户密码、银行类账户密码、服务器类账户密码或其他需要加密存储的文本信息。
主权项:1.一种基于国密算法实现的个人隐私数据保存方法,其特征在于,包括以下步骤:步骤1、用户输入用户名以及登录密码进行登录,系统判断用户是否存在:若用户不存在,则为用户分配对应的存储空间,不同用户的存储空间相互独立,将登录密码通过SM3加以偏移量单向多次加密之后生成的密文对比密码uKey存储在为当前用户所分配的存储空间内,用于下次登录校验之用,进入步骤2;若用户存在,则从当前用户所分配的存储空间内取出密文对比密码uKey后与用户输入的登录密码进行对比,若比对失败,则阻止用户登录,若比对成功,则进入步骤2;其中,用户所有数据均存储在本地;步骤2、进行分类管理、列表管理、数据导入导出或密码变更重新加密,其中:进行分类管理操作时:建立多个分类将用户数据进行归类,该分类数据使用SM2一级加密进行保存;进行列表管理操作时:在不同分类新建业务数据,之后将隐私类的关键数据进行一级AES加密,此时,密文对比密码uKey参与本次加密;之后,经过一级AES加密的数据整体进行SM2二级加密,所形成的加密密文存储在当前用户所分配的存储空间下;进行数据导入导出操作时:能够将分类数据或者业务数据进行导出,导出文件为压缩文本;其他用户进行数据导入操作时,需要导入密码才能进行导入;进行密码变更重新加密操作时:改变登录密码,导致当前用户的密文对比密码uKey发生变化,密文对比密码uKey变化后将当前用户的密文文件进行重新加密,形成新的加密密文存储在当前用户所分配的存储空间下。
全文数据:
权利要求:
百度查询: 健康云(上海)数字科技有限公司 基于国密算法实现的个人隐私数据保存方法
免责声明
1、本报告根据公开、合法渠道获得相关数据和信息,力求客观、公正,但并不保证数据的最终完整性和准确性。
2、报告中的分析和结论仅反映本公司于发布本报告当日的职业理解,仅供参考使用,不能作为本公司承担任何法律责任的依据或者凭证。